Abstract

The invention discloses a large-area warming protection device for burn patients, which relates to the field of medical instruments and comprises a protection bottom plate and an arc-shaped upper cover, wherein a bottom heating warming mechanism is installed on the upper side of the protection bottom plate, a top warming mechanism is installed on the inner side of the arc-shaped upper cover, an air inlet mechanism is installed in the middle of a semicircular host machine, an air exchange mechanism is installed in the middle of the arc-shaped upper cover, a heater and a control processor are installed in the semicircular host machine, a touch panel is installed on the top of the semicircular host machine, and the control processor is electrically connected with the bottom heating warming mechanism, the top warming mechanism, the air inlet mechanism, the air exchange mechanism, the touch panel and the. The invention has novel design, simple structure and convenient and fast use, can play the roles of isolation and protection, temperature regulation and heat preservation, ensures the flow and cleanness of air in the treatment environment, improves the healing speed and comfort of patients and is suitable for popularization and use.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Referring to fig. 1-6, a large area burn patient uses the guard base plate 1 and arc upper cover 2, both ends of the guard base plate 1 are fixedly equipped with the handle 19, the arc upper cover 2 is covered on the guard base plate 1 to form the semi-cylinder structure, the end of the guard base plate 1 is fixedly equipped with the semi-circular host 3 vertical to it, the front end of the arc upper cover 2 is fixedly equipped with the semi-circular baffle 4 vertical to it, the middle part of the semi-circular baffle 4 is equipped with the arc hole 5, and the arc hole 5 is equipped with the elastic silica gel protection sheet 6, the guard base plate 1 is the rectangle structure, and the arc upper cover 2 is mounted on one side of the guard base plate 1 through the hinge, the upside of the guard base plate 1 is equipped with the bottom heating and warming mechanism, the inside of the arc upper cover 2 is equipped with the top warming mechanism, the middle part of the semi-circular host 3 is equipped, the heater 16 and the control processor 17 are installed in the semicircular host machine 3, the touch panel 18 is installed at the top of the semicircular host machine 3, the control processor 17 is electrically connected with the bottom heating and warming mechanism, the top warming mechanism, the air inlet mechanism 15, the ventilation mechanism 14, the touch panel 18 and the heater 16, the air inlet mechanism 15 and the ventilation mechanism 14 respectively comprise a ventilation channel 20, a filter element 22 and a fan 21, the filter element 22 and the fan 21 are fixedly installed in the ventilation channel 20, and the fan 21 is electrically connected with the control processor 17.
The bottom heating and warm keeping mechanism comprises a bottom heating pipe 7, a moisture-proof grid plate 8 and a protection pad 9, the bottom heating pipe 7 is laid in the protection bottom plate 1, the moisture-proof grid plate 8 is mounted above the bottom heating pipe 7 in an overhead mode, the protection pad 9 is laid on the moisture-proof grid plate 8, and the bottom heating pipe 7 is connected with a heater 16.
The top heating mechanism comprises a top heating pipe 10, a moving track 11 and a moving heating component, the top heating pipe 10 is fixedly paved on one side, rotating towards the protective bottom plate 1, of the arc-shaped upper cover 2, the moving track 11 is installed on two sides of the arc-shaped upper cover 2, the moving heating component is movably installed between the two moving tracks 11, and the top heating pipe 10 is connected with the heater 16.
The movable heating component comprises a driving part 12, a mounting plate and a movable heating pipe 10, the driving part 12 is installed at two ends of the mounting plate, the two driving parts 12 are movably installed on the two movable rails 11, the mounting plate is of an arc structure matched with the arc upper cover 2, the movable heating pipe 13 is fixedly laid on the mounting plate, and the movable heating pipe 13 is connected with the heater 16.
When the invention is used, a patient lies on the protection pad 9, the moisture-proof grid plate 8 leads the bottom of the patient to obtain a certain amount of overhead, avoids the situation that the patient gathers at the bottom of the protection bottom plate 1 in a certain period and the temperature is too high due to the direct contact of the bottom heating pipe 7 with the patient, the arc-shaped upper cover 2 is covered, the neck of the patient is positioned at the arc-shaped hole 5 and covered at the position through the silica gel protection sheet 6 to be sealed, the body of the patient is isolated from the outside at the moment, the infection of wound surfaces caused by the contact of the outside air with the body of the patient is avoided, the patient does not need to cover a cotton quilt or cover gauze and the like when lying in the interior, the bottom heating pipe 7 and the top heating pipe 10 can heat and warm the inner space, the temperature can be regulated and controlled through the touch panel 18, the use is very convenient, when the specific position needs to be warmed, the control driving part 12 is controlled through the control panel, the bottom heating pipe 7 and the top heating pipe 10 do not need to be completely opened, so that the energy consumption is greatly reduced, and the energy-saving and environment-friendly effects are achieved; meanwhile, when the air inlet mechanism 15 and the air exchange mechanism 14 are started, the fan 21 of the air inlet mechanism 15 introduces air into the device, the air is filtered when passing through the filter element 22, the cleanliness of the air entering the device is ensured, infection is avoided, the fan 21 of the air exchange mechanism 14 discharges the air in the device to the outside, the filter element 22 ensures that the outside air cannot enter the device from the air exchange mechanism 14, the flow exchange of the inside air and the outside air is realized, the plot of the inside air is ensured, and the curing speed is accelerated.
